'scrcpy' 不是内部或外部命令,也不是可运行的程序 或批处理文件。怎么解决
时间: 2024-06-25 14:01:10 浏览: 334
idea 控制台或cmd窗口报’mvn’ 不是内部或外部命令,也不是可运行的程序 或批处理文件。
'Scrcpy' 是一个用于 Android 设备屏幕录制和操控的开源工具。当你遇到 "不是内部或外部命令,也不是可运行的程序或批处理文件" 的错误时,这通常意味着你在 Windows 系统中尝试运行 scrpy 命令,但系统找不到对应的可执行文件。
解决这个问题的步骤如下:
1. **检查安装**:
- 确保你已经从官方网站(https://github.com/Genymobile/scrcpy)下载了正确的平台版本(Windows x86或x64),并且按照指示安装到系统的 PATH 环境变量中。如果你没有添加到 PATH,需要手动指定完整路径来运行 scrpy。
2. **环境变量设置**:
- 打开命令提示符或 PowerShell,并输入 `where scrpy.exe` 来检查 scrpy 是否在 PATH 中能找到。如果没有,你需要手动添加它到系统环境变量的 Path 变量中。
3. **文件路径问题**:
- 如果你是从特定目录直接运行,确保你正在使用的是 scrpy.exe 文件,而不是其他同名文件。可能需要先切换到安装目录再运行。
4. **更新或重新安装**:
- 如果安装过程出现问题,试着卸载后再重新安装,确保所有步骤都正确执行。
5. **权限问题**:
- 如果你在管理员权限下运行命令仍然失败,尝试以管理员身份运行命令提示符或 PowerShell。
如果以上方法都无法解决问题,可能是 scrpy 安装过程中出现了异常,建议查阅相关文档或在项目 GitHub 页面提交问题,寻求技术支持。同时,请确认你下载的 scrpy 版本适用于你的操作系统和 Android 版本。
阅读全文